Solana Holds Near $73 as Weak On-Chain Activity Signals Uncertainty

Solana trades near $73 amid declining on-chain activity and lower volumes even as MoneyGram joins its network and governance efforts expand.

TokenPost.ai

Solana (SOL) is holding near the closely watched $73 level as the broader crypto market stays in a corrective phase, leaving traders torn between a potential technical rebound and lingering headwinds from weakening on-chain activity. The token’s failure to reclaim nearby resistance has kept downside risks in focus, even as the Solana ecosystem posts incremental signs of institutional participation and governance maturation.

As of Friday, Aug. 1 at 4:41 p.m. UTC, SOL traded at $72.83, down 0.31% over the past 24 hours. The token is lower by 1.92% over the last seven days and has slid 9.23% over the past month, reflecting a broader risk-off tone across digital assets.

Market watchers say SOL has been confined to a tight $73–$75 band, with multiple technical levels capping upside attempts. The 50-day moving average near $74.9 and the 100-day moving average around $75.8 are widely cited as key resistance zones. On the downside, analysts flag the $73.75 area as an important support marker; a sustained break below that level could open the door to renewed selling pressure.

Trading activity has also cooled notably. Spot volume over the past 24 hours was about $917.29 million, but that figure fell 44.8% from the prior day—an indication of shrinking participation and growing uncertainty around near-term direction. In market terms, thinning volume often reflects fading conviction, making breakouts and breakdowns more difficult to validate.

Beyond price action, security concerns have drawn fresh attention. Michael Coates, chief information security officer (CISO) of the Solana Foundation, recently warned that AI-enabled scams—particularly deepfakes—are becoming a serious threat to crypto users. According to Coates, attackers are increasingly relying on social engineering to steal 'private keys' and 'seed phrases', leveraging more convincing synthetic audio and video to impersonate public figures or project representatives in phishing campaigns.

The warning has renewed calls for basic operational security across the ecosystem, including stronger two-factor authentication, verifying communications through official channels, and avoiding suspicious links. Industry participants note that as AI tools lower the barrier to producing realistic impersonations, user-level security hygiene becomes a more central pillar of network safety.

Still, the ecosystem continues to broaden in ways that some investors view as constructive. MoneyGram, the global remittance company, has joined the Solana network as an 'active validator' and became part of the Solana Developer Platform. Observers see the move as notable because it places a traditional finance brand directly in the validator set, contributing to network security and decentralization rather than merely integrating at the application layer.

Solana has also taken steps to formalize network decision-making by introducing the SGP (Solana Governance Proposal) system. Under the framework, validators can vote on core governance proposals via on-chain ballots weighted by staking. Supporters argue that the structure should improve transparency and reinforce decentralization by tying governance outcomes to stake-backed participation, a feature that long-term holders often associate with protocol maturity.

Against those positive signals, another datapoint has weighed on sentiment: a reported slowdown in Solana-based decentralized exchange (DEX) activity. Analysts say weaker DEX volumes can reflect softer network usage and reduced organic demand, potentially translating into slower price recovery. The article cited 24-hour DEX volume of roughly $9,294—a figure that stands in stark contrast to the $917.28 million recorded in centralized exchange (CEX) trading, underscoring how much current liquidity is concentrated off-chain.

By market capitalization, Solana remains one of the largest crypto assets, with a valuation of about $42.32 billion, ranking seventh overall and representing an estimated 1.96% of total market dominance. Circulating supply is listed at approximately 581.07 million SOL against a total supply near 631.37 million, with a fully diluted valuation (FDV) of about $45.98 billion—suggesting a relatively modest gap between circulating and fully diluted figures compared with some high-emission networks.

For now, SOL’s next leg likely hinges on whether it can reclaim the $74.9–$75.8 resistance cluster and whether on-chain activity stabilizes. In parallel, heightened attention to 'security awareness' and continued progress on 'on-chain governance' could shape broader confidence in the ecosystem as the market looks for durable narratives beyond short-term price fluctuations.
